Brisbane Roar vs Western Sydney Wanderers: form, goals and key statistics
Game details
Brisbane Roar played against Western Sydney Wanderers in A-League (Australia). The game was played on March 13, 2026. Final score: 2:2.
Recent form
Brisbane Roar has 0 wins, 2 draws and 3 losses over its last five games, averaging 0.40 points per game. Western Sydney Wanderers has 1 win, 2 draws and 2 losses, with 1.00 points per game.
Scoring records
Brisbane Roar scores 0.95 goals per game and allows 1.25. Western Sydney Wanderers scores 1.10 and allows 1.40. Games in this league average 2.82 goals.
BTTS and goal totals
Both teams score in 50% of Brisbane Roar's games and 50% of Western Sydney Wanderers's. The Over 2.5 rates are 45% and 40%, compared with league averages of 57% for BTTS and 55% for Over 2.5.
xG and shots
Western Sydney Wanderers has the higher season xG average, 1.61 to 1.40 per game. Brisbane Roar takes 13.4 shots per game, while Western Sydney Wanderers takes 15.1.
First-half and second-half trends
Brisbane Roar leads at halftime in 25% of its games and scores 0.45 goals per game after halftime. Western Sydney Wanderers leads at halftime in 30% and scores 0.45 after halftime.
When the teams score
Brisbane Roar's most productive scoring window is minutes 31-45+ (6 goals). For Western Sydney Wanderers, it is minutes 0-15 (6 goals). These are past scoring patterns, not predicted goal times.
League scoring profile
A-League games average 2.82 goals. Both teams score in 57% of games, and 55% finish with at least three goals.
Head-to-head record
Before this game, one previous meeting was available. The record was 0 home wins, 1 draw and 0 away wins. Those games averaged 0.00 goals, with both teams scoring in 0% of them.
